1. (Aster)

Aster

Aster is one of the most popular flowers starting with A. The Greek word for “star” is its name, and its petals resemble tiny stars. Aster blooms in late summer and fall, making it a great choice for summer blooming flowers when most plants begin to fade. Gardeners love Asters because they are low-maintenance flowers starting with A and bring charm to flower beds. 

2. (Allium)

Allium

Allium is known as the ornamental onion. Its round globe of purple or white flowers makes it one of the most striking ornamental flowers A. They are also great as perennial flowers with A because they come back year after year. Their tall stems add drama to any garden design with flowers beginning with A. 

3. (Alyssum)

Allyssum

Alyssum, often called Sweet Alyssum, is one of the most fragrant annual flowers with A. Its tiny clusters of white, pink, or purple blooms create a carpet of beauty. Many people search for easy-to-grow flowers starting with A, and Alyssum is always on that list. It can be planted in borders, pots, or hanging baskets.

5. (Anemone

 Anemone

Anemone is also called a windflower. It is one of the most unique flowers A with its delicate petals that sway in the wind. It can be grown as a spring or fall bloomer depending on the type. Gardeners love it as part of garden flowers A because it adds color early in the season. 

6. (Alstroemeria

Alstroemeria 

Alstroemeria, also called Peruvian Lily, is one of the best flowers starting with A used in weddings. It has striped petals that make it look exotic. It lasts long in vases, so it is popular in flowering plants for bouquets. 

7. (Alchemilla

Alchemilla

Alchemilla, sometimes known as Lady’s Mantle, is frequently used as ground cover. It is valued in gardens as shade tolerant flowers and grows easily under trees. The soft green leaves collect raindrops, creating a magical look. Its meaning is connected to protection and healing. Historically, it was thought to possess magical abilities.

8. (Angelonia)

Angelonia 

Angelonia is sometimes called Summer Snapdragon. It is a flower that blooms in the summer and lasts until the ice. Gardeners in the USA love it because it thrives in heat and is considered a drought resistant flower. 

9.( Arum) 

Arum

Arum’s stunning spathes, which are sometimes mistaken for calla lilies, are what make it most famous. It is a striking addition to the list of flowers that start with A because of its unique structure. Arums grow well in damp areas and are often planted near water features. 

10. (Astilbe)

Astilbe

Astilbe is a feathery, delicate blossom that adds color to areas that get shade. It is highly valued as one of the flowers that grow well in shade beginning with A. Its fluffy plumes come in white, pink, and red, adding color where few plants thrive. 

11. (African Daisy

African Daisy

African Daisy, also called Osteospermum, is a sun-loving bloom. It is considered one of the best flowers starting with A for gardens because of its vibrant colors. These daisies are often planted in large groups to create a sea of color.

13. (Amaranthus )

Amaranthus 

Amaranthus, often called Love-Lies-Bleeding, has cascading red flowers. It is one of the most unique flowers A and has a dramatic look. It grows well in warm climates and is a favorite in heritage gardens. 

14. (Anthericum

Anthericum 

St. Bernard’s Lily, or Anthericum, is a stylish plant with white flowers shaped like stars. It is one of the perennial flowers with A that grows easily in meadows and gardens. 

15. (Aubrieta )

Aubrieta 

In the early spring, aubrieta, a pretty ground-cover flower, spreads like a carpet of blue, pink, or purple. It is one of the best perennial flowers with A, loved for filling gaps between rocks and garden edges. Aubrieta thrives in sunny spots and is often used in garden design with flowers beginning with A because it creates a natural, colorful border.

16. (Angel Trumpet

 Angel Trumpet 

Angel Trumpet is an exotic flowering plant with large, trumpet-shaped blooms that hang gracefully from the branches. These unique flowers A are famous for their fragrance, which fills the evening air. They are often grown in warm climates and are admired as exotic flowers A because of their striking look.
